- Earthy comedy about the four motherless Wheeler children and their lovable, but cantankerous, father Zack. With Zack avoiding work, Truckie led the clan, with Doobie, Boo, and T. J.
- Truckie falls hard for the local librarian but learns she has dreams that involve moving away.
- Zack is determined to return to Superstition Mountain and locate the Lost Dutchman mine. Daughter Boo insists on going with him.
- Zack discovers a pile of junk and after being told it's worth something, conducts a sale. But he accidentally deposes of daughter Boo's music box and the family frantically tries to get it back.
- Truckie is tired of working multiple jobs plus chores at home to support the family and decides to go on strike.
- The four motherless Wheeler kids are managing, watched over by the eldest Truckie. The father Zack, who disappeared years ago, returns but still seems irresponsible. Doobie refuses to go to school so Truckie must change his mind.
- Truckie is on the warpath when he discovers a dent in his truck. He is determined to make someone pay and his suspicions land on Zack who used the vehicle the night before.
- When a tornado approaching Lamont Truckie takes the kids to safety in town. Zack and Doobie are forced to ride out the storm in the basement of the family home.
- Doobie gets a date with a pretty classmate and friends suggest he watch a porn film to learn the "facts". Double quickly quits watching and asks hos brother Truckie instead.
